Factors to Consider When Choosing Drone GPS Trackers
When choosing a drone GPS tracker, you need to contemplate several key factors. Think about compatibility with your drone model, tracking range accuracy, and battery life duration. Additionally, the charging port type and the weight and size of the tracker can greatly impact your flying experience.
Compatibility With Drone Models
Choosing the right GPS tracker for your drone requires careful consideration of compatibility with your specific model. Make certain the tracker is designed for your drone type, especially if it’s a well-known brand, to avoid installation issues. It’s also wise to check if the tracker supports various aircraft types, like multi-rotor, fixed-wing, and hybrid VTOL, which adds versatility to your fleet. Don’t forget to verify that the tracker complies with FAA regulations for drones over 250g to guarantee legal flight operations. Additionally, look for compatibility with Bluetooth versions and protocols to enhance connectivity and data transmission. Finally, confirm that the tracker offers real-time tracking accuracy within a few meters for reliable location updates during your flights.
Tracking Range Accuracy
After ensuring your GPS tracker is compatible with your drone model, the next step is evaluating its tracking range accuracy. This accuracy is vital for effective drone recovery, so look for devices that offer real-time tracking ranges between 500 to 1000 meters. It’s also important to take into account GPS positioning accuracy; some systems provide precision within 3 meters, greatly improving your chances of locating a lost drone. Keep in mind that environmental factors, like obstacles and signal interference, can affect operational range. Some GPS trackers come with built-in buzzers to help locate drones by emitting sound, further enhancing recovery chances. Real-time updates on altitude, speed, and location will also contribute to overall tracking accuracy, allowing you to monitor your drone’s flight path effectively.

Weather Resistance Rating
When evaluating drone GPS trackers, it is crucial to take into account their weather resistance ratings, which reveal how well a device can withstand environmental challenges. Look for IP ratings that indicate protection against dust and water. For instance, an IP54 rating offers limited dust protection and splashes of water, making it suitable for light rain and dusty conditions. If you’re flying in more extreme environments, consider a tracker with an IPX8 rating, which can endure prolonged immersion in water. Choosing a GPS tracker with a robust weather resistance rating enhances durability and reliability, ensuring your device lasts longer and requires less maintenance.
